Sublime Text – #1 Best Text Editor for Windows
- Has Free version for testing. It costs $80/user.
With Sublime Text, you will get a distraction-free text or code editing. It is a feature-rich and most sophisticated editor. It is a lightweight editor and ensures unmatched responsiveness. The custom UI toolkit gives optimized speed and accuracy. Further, Sublime Text works great for coding, markup, prose, etc.

It is completely customizable with JSON files. The shortcuts are powerful and user-friendly. It supports a lot of markup and programming languages. With the powerful Python API, you can integrate plugins with this text editor.
Atom
- Open source text editor
The best text editor for Windows PC includes Atom. It supports developers to work together for better software development. So, Atoms is all about sharing workspace and editing codes in real-time together. The editor is sleek and includes great organization tools. With a built-in package manager, searching, installing, and creating new packages is easy.

Its smart auto-completion option helps you write codes faster. Computing and editing code across files is easy with multiple panes. Atom’s UI is highly customizable with CSS/Less, HTML, JavaScript. The file system browser makes browsing and opening single or multiple projects easily. For all these and more, it is referred to as a hackable text editor of this century. Notepad++
- Free source code editor
Access powerful editing components with Notepad++ text editor. It is one of the best text editors for Windows with advanced features. Notepad++ is useful for developers as well as content creators. Since it is based on Microsoft Windows, it uses less computing power.

It supports syntax highlighting and folding with the multi-view editor. Notepad++ includes auto-completion settings. Thus, it completes functions, words, and parameters automatically. The multi-document interface lets you switch between tabs and projects.
Visual Studio Code – #Popular Text Editor
- Free and open source text editor
VScode or Visual Studio Code is one of the best text editors for Windows. It is more preferred by the developers with advanced features support. With IntelliSense, variable types, function definitions, modules get completed automatically. It provides an option to debug the code on the editor itself.

It features an ever-growing library of plugins. With Zen mode, remove all the menus and items from the editor. It is a streamlined code editor and works for development operations. It includes debugging, version control, task running, etc.
Brackets
- Open source text editor
If you want a modern text editor for Windows, then choose Brackets. It is a lightweight yet powerful and easy-to-use editor. Brackets work great for front-end developers and web designers. Writing codes is a breeze with the inline editor support.

The built-in extension manager provides fast and effective extension management. Use the live preview to see the changes in CSS and HTML instantly. Working with a preprocessor is easy as Brackets let you use Quick Edit and Live highlights with LESS and SCSS files.

UltraEdit – #Fastest Text Editor for Windows
- 30-day free trial. Price starts at $79.95/year
If you are looking for the most secured text editor, then choose UltraEdit. This best text editor for Windows has numerous features. It is a flexible editor and has lots of customization options. For instance, users can choose from available themes or create a new theme from scratch. It is the fastest text editor when it comes to finding files and editing codes.

Use the live preview option to view your programming process visually. UltraEdit supports editing even large files without crashing. It has built-in FTP, SSH, Telnet, and other developer features. Its user-interface of this editor is highly customizable.
Komodo Edit
- Free and open source text editor
The best text editor for Windows includes Komodo Edit. It is a powerful yet simple to use best text editor for Windows. Komodo Edit is robust and supports different functions. It includes debugging, code refactoring, code profiling, unit testing, etc. Komodo Edit works for those less experienced and advanced users as well.

This multi-language editor supports auto-complete, multiple selections, toolbox, skins, etc. Thus this editor is most ideal for web development. Get Komodo Edit IDE for more advanced features like slack sharing, docker integration, etc.
Bluefish
- Free text editor
If handling multiple files simultaneously is your target, then get Bluefish. It is the best text editor for web developers, programmers, etc. In addition, it is useful for those who write websites, scripts, and programming codes. With Bluefish, developers can proceed with remote editing.

It loads several hundred files in few seconds. Bluefish auto recovers changes done after a kill, crash, or shutdown. It supports unlimited undo or redo functions.
GNU Emacs
- Free text editor
Emacs is a customizable and extensible text editor that works on Windows PC. It is Unix-based and is a go-to option by programmers, system admins, and more. Emacs features content-aware editing modes like syntax coloring. Beyond text editing, it has a wide range of functions. For instance, debugger interface, IRC client, project planner, etc.

With Lisp code or graphical interface, the text editor is highly customizable. It offers better support for text shaping, Cairo drawing, etc. Above all, installing and downloading extensions is easy with the packaging system.
EmEditor – Extensible Text Editor
- Costs $39.99 after free trial
The best Windows text editor includes EmEditor. It is a lightweight editor that works faster. Get the support of Unicode, powerful macros, and large files. The coding features include syntax highlighting, configurations, multi-selection editing, etc.

It has a customizable interface and tabbed design. EmEditor is versatile with Unicode features, portability, and more. Further, it lets users filter text documents as well as CSV documents.
jEdit
- Open source text editor
jEdit is a Java-based text editor with Windows compatibility. It has built-in macro language support and extensible plugin architecture. jEdit includes an auto-indent and a large number of character encodings. Above all, it supports syntax highlighting in 200+ languages.

It is a highly customizable and configurable text editor. With jEdit, you will get the Word wrap feature. It includes all the basic and advanced features that any text editor will hold.
